发明名称 METHOD FOR MANUFACTURING ALUMINUM ALLOY IN WHICH Al-Fe-Si-BASED COMPOUND IS MINIATURIZED
摘要 To provide a manufacturing method of an inexpensive aluminum alloy that allows fine crystallization of the Al-Fe-Si compound and primary Si by employing a convenient and efficient means. To molten aluminum alloy comprising: 8 to 20% by mass of Si; 0.5 to 4% by mass of Fe; and, as necessary, at least any one of 0.005 to 2.5% by mass of Mn and no greater than 0.5% by mass of Cr; at least any one of 0.5 to 6% by mass of Ni, 0.5 to 8% by mass of Cu, and 0.05 to 1.5% by mass of Mg; 0.003 to 0.02% by mass of P; and the balance being Al and inevitable impurities, AlB 2 , which is present as a solid phase in molten metal upon crystallization of the Al-Fe-Si compound, is added in such an amount that B is in a range of 0.01 to 0.5% by mass with respect to entire molten aluminum alloy. As the AlB 2 , it is preferable to use an Al-B alloy, which comprises B as the AlB 2 .
